The cutoff required for BTech in Civil Engineering at Kurukshetra University is currently unknown. The Kurukshetra University reveals the cutoff rank for its BTech courses after the conclusion of the JEE Mains entrance exam. Candidates who wish to gain admission into the BTech in Civil Engineering course must register for the JEE Mains entrance examination.

While IIT Kanpur is one of India's premier institutes, the placement scenario for B.Tech in Civil Engineering is moderate compared to highly sought-after branches like CSE or Electrical Engineering. Typically, around 60–70% of Civil Engineering students secure placements, with average packages hovering around ?16–17 LPA. Top recruiters include companies in infrastructure, construction, and government projects, offering roles such as Structural Engineer, Project Manager, and Site Engineer. To secure admission in B.Tech Civil Engineering at Chandigarh University, students need to go through the university's own entrance exam, CUCET, which is mandatory for taking admission in Engineering domain. This exam not only determines admission but also provides a chance to win scholarships based on merit. The eligibiltity criteria require students to have passed 10+2 with Physics and Mathematics as compulsory subjects and at least one optional subject such as Chemistry, Computer Science, or Biology, with a minimum of 50% marks.
